About Koomer Ridge Campground

This Campground offers dozens of shaded, wooded campsites. 54 suitable for tents and 19 suitable for a trailer. Camping and fires are prohibited in rock shelters.  

Number of accommodations: 31

Policies & Rules

Arrival & departure

Check out time

12PM

General

  • Please Note: One RV with tow vehicle per single site or one vehicle per tent site. Most sites can accommodate 1 extra vehicle that is not included with the reservation fee. Extra vehicle will be charged a per night fee and collected at the campground.
  • Reserved Sites will be held until the day following your arrival date. Sites must be occupied by the checkout time of that following day to hold a reservation or the site will be forfeited and released to other guests. Once your reservation start date has begun, neither the Recreation.gov Contact Center nor the campground manager will be able to modify your reservation.
  • Fire Restrictions: Fire restrictions may be imposed at any time due to hot, dry weather conditions, at which time campfires and charcoal fires may not be allowed.  
  • Don't Move Firewood: Protect Kentucky's forests from tree-killing pests by buying your firewood locally and burning it on-site. For more information visit https://www.dontmovefirewood.org/ 
  • For more information about the Daniel Boone National Forest, click here https://www.fs.usda.gov/dbnf 
  • 2 pets are allowed per site.
  • No electricity at the campground.
  • This is Bear Country! For bear and human safety, keep a clean campsite and do not place food or other attractants in your tent. 
  • Refunds: Refund requests made through www.recreation.gov will be charged a $10 processing fee. This fee is retained by the reservation service contractor along with the non-refundable reservation fee. All requests for the return of the non-refundable reservation fee and the cancellation fee will be declined by the campground concessionaire as they did not receive these fees (these are the fees retained by the reservation contractor, a different entity).
